ReadyMarin is committed to empowering the Marin County community take control of their safety and preparedness in the face of any emergency. We're partnering with agencies across the County to offer free, hands-on 90 minute workshops. Whether you are just getting started with preparedness or want to strengthen your current plans, this class will give you the confidence and tools to act safely and support you and your loved ones.
You'll learn essential skills, such as how to:
- Understand and respond to emergency alerts
- Create a personal disaster plan
- Use a fire-extinguisher
- Perform hands-only CPR
